Anti-statisk filterelement fra Hydac
Posted: 03.09.2010
Enkelte nye hydraulikkoljer leder strøm svært dårlig og dette kan bli en utfordring i systemer. Når olje med liten ledeevne strømmer gjennom et filter vil det normalt dannes elektrostatisk ladning i glassfibrene i filterduken.

SMM News - BRUDE MES for special purpose ships
Posted: 01.09.2010
A Marine Evacuation System (MES), consisting of a slide or chute where passengers can evacuate straight into waiting life rafts, can often be found on modern high speed crafts and passenger ships, where weight, space and evacuation times must be kept to a minimum.

Historic artic sea route opens
Posted: 27.08.2010
For the first time ever, a bulk carrier with non-Russian flag is using the Northern Sea Route as a transit trade lane, when transporting iron ore from the Northern part of Norway to China via Arctic and Russian waters.
